This is not your fancy sandwich place, this is your Italian hole in the wall, fresh deli meat on bread kinda place with a cappuccino on the side kinda place. Whatever the Italian version of a greasy spoon is, this is it (but without the grease).
Family owned and run they make top tier sandwiches and lovely coffee at a price you shouldn't be able to get in central London (I'm surprised more students are coming here for their fill).
Some of the other stuff outside of the sandwiches can be a bit hit or miss, but for the price I don't think you're justified to complain.
My only fault would be sometimes, closer to the evening they run out of the nice soft bread they use and the alternative doesnt quite hit the same, but still this place is far far better than a lot of the other sandwich places nearby and it's open, somehow, pretty much all day.

Read moreMy favourite local Italian when working down Fitzrovia area. Great for breakfast, lunchtime and dinner with a selection of Italian breakfasts both vegetarian and meat options including scrambled eggs with mozzarella and then a choice of Italian cured meats or vegetarian antipasti. Lunch has great Italian sandwiches where the cured meats are carved fresh for every sandwich, no premade! The Picanti is great as is the traditional Parma Ham. The salads are also great too as is the pasta. In a world were Fitzrovia has been taken over by chain restaurants and 'hip' bistros it's nice to see this local Family run, traditional Italian cafe still doing well! I have been coming here for 11 years and see the same faces who always say hello so trust me!
